Proper Restoration of Excitation-Contraction Coupling in the Dihydropyridine Receptor β(1)-null Zebrafish Relaxed Is an Exclusive Function of the β(1a) Subunit

The paralyzed zebrafish strain relaxed carries a null mutation for the skeletal muscle dihydropyridine receptor (DHPR) β(1a) subunit.
